Astronomy for Muggle Kids: Harry Potter - ASTRONA KAZAM THE ANDROMEDA GALAXY: Andromeda Tonks is Sirius' closest cousin.  The Andromeda Galaxy is the closest galaxy of our own! The Constellation Draco: is in the north near the little dipper.  Gamma Draconis is the brightest star in Draco.  In legends, Draco is a dragon (what's that say about Draco Malfoy?)
The Harry Potter universe is full of references to REAL celestial objects!  From Sirius to Draco to Luna, muggle astronomers have been watching them for centuries...
